Formula Analysis: Key Assets
Three major assets catch my attention:
- Ascorbyl Glucoside : A stable derivative of vitamin C, it acts as a powerful antioxidant, stimulates collagen synthesis, and brightens the complexion. Its mode of action helps fight free radicals and reduce pigmentation spots.
- SH-Oligopeptide-1 : An epidermal growth factor, it promotes cell regeneration, accelerates skin repair, and improves skin texture, contributing to smoother, firmer skin.
- Centella Asiatica and its derivatives Known for its soothing and restorative properties, it strengthens the skin barrier, reduces inflammation, and promotes healing, making it ideal for sensitive or blemish-prone skin.
The presence of squalane, hyaluronic acid, and panthenol completes the formula by providing hydration and comfort.
Tips and Application Ritual
I recommend applying this serum in the morning, on clean, dry skin, before moisturizer and sunscreen. It can also be used in the evening to boost nighttime regeneration. It is compatible with most active ingredients, but I do not recommend combining it with powerful exfoliating acids (AHAs/BHAs) to avoid irritation. It fits perfectly into an anti-aging or radiance routine.
